If you look at the design documents for the roads in your area, usually available in plain old PDF files at your State DOT website... it usually states both the designed speed, and what the posted speed will be.
If it's a modern road, it is almost certainly designed for 5-10mph over what the posted limit will be. Because they know most traffic will speed, and that is accounted for in the road design, regardless of the posted limit sign.

That's not at all what's being said. Knowing the speed people will want to drive with a specific design, doesn't make it inherently "too fast", its the exact opposite. The road designers are literally designing what the road condition will feel like to drivers, then taking the human factor into account to set a sensible limit instead of an arbitrary one.
If they know the road design will make people drive 50mph, and that most people drive 5mph over the posted limit, they post a 45mph limit. Driving at 50mph down that road is not "too fast", that's literally what was designed to feel correct.
There have been several studies over the years about posted versus real world speeds. Including studies of the same road with the posted speed being changed and monitoring driver behavior. They found that regardless of what the posted sign says, people usually drove about the same speed on that road. The minimum and maximum speeds varied with different signs as some people used that number directly, but the average of all traffic stayed the same regardless of the signage because that's the speed that felt correct for that roadway. In some cases that was under the posted limit, in others that average was up to 10 over the posted limit.
Most roads do not have posted speed limits that vary dramatically from the speed that feels right on that road, because they're designed for a specific speed and posted with that consideration. Artificially low speed limits are not common. They're usually from a speed being changed years after the road was designed and built, so it wasn't intended to have drivers at that speed and also wasn't physically changed to help reinforce that speed subconsciously, or from a town trying to boost ticket revenue.

The problem is not in individual roads or individual road designs. Though we often have to use the thought of an individual road to describe the problem. Which is what I was doing through analogy. The problem is that there is nothing put into the design to account for the impact on the way people drive based on the design parameters themselves.
It is a feedback loop that is not being taken into consideration by the design guidelines of American road infrastructure. The very basic "post the height of the bridge as 1 ft lower than it actually is" is being applied to speed limits and road design. When this type of thinking is far too simplistic for a much more complex system of human interaction with the road and other humans themselves.
The truck driver that drives a 10ft tall truck that fits under a bridge with a posted 9 ft 11in tall sign doesn't think "hmmm I bet I could fit my 10ft 1in truck under here as well".
But drivers do have these more complex thoughts and interactions with the road that they drive down every day.
